Youre chnage don't work. You need to change the function i2c gate of tda1048
for the one of tda1023, but the parameter of this function must be the fe
pointer of tda1023. If this is a problem, I can duplicate tda1023 i2c gate in
ttusb2 code and pass it to the tda10048. It is done this way in the first patch
of this thread.

Yes I now see why it cannot work - since FE is given as a parameter to i2c_gate_ctrl it does not see correct priv and used I2C addr is read from priv. You must implement own i2c_gate_ctrl in ttusb2 driver. Implement own ct3650_i2c_gate_ctrl and override tda10048 i2c_gate_ctrl using that. Then call tda10023 i2c_gate_ctrl but instead of tda10048 FE use td10023 FE. Something like

static int ct3650_i2c_gate_ctrl(struct dvb_frontend* fe, int enable)
{
	return adap->mfe[0]->ops.i2c_gate_ctrl(POINTER_TO_TDA10023_FE, enable);
}

/* tuner is behind TDA10023 I2C-gate */
adap->mfe[1]->ops.i2c_gate_ctrl = ct3650_i2c_gate_ctrl;
